1. An interface for car-mounted devices comprising:

  • hand data detecting means for detecting hand data indicative of a state of a hand of an operator;

    voice recognizing means for recognizing a voice utterance of the operator; and

    control signal-forming means for specifying a subject device to be controlled among the car-mounted devices and a commanded control operation of the subject device based upon a combination of a result of the detection made by the hand data detecting means and a result of the recognition made by the voice recognizing means, and thereafter forming a corresponding control signal for the subject device, whereinwhen a preset demonstrative pronoun that has been set in advance is recognized by the voice recognizing means, the control signal-forming means specifies the subject device based on the hand data detected by the hand data detecting means, and forms the control signal, which changes an operating state of the subject device.
